Bill to establish Central Highlands Protection Authority to be presented to Parliament - President

President Anura Kumara Dissanayake stated that steps are being taken to pass the Central Highlands Protection Authority Bill in Parliament by the end of this year or early next year, thereby granting the Authority all necessary powers to protect that ecosystem.

 

The President made these remarks while attending the ceremonial handover of the ‘Navodayapuram’ housing project to the public. The project was constructed for families who lost their homes in the Poonagala Kabaragala Mountain landslide in Bandarawela in 2023.

 

He also stated that steps are being taken to establish the Central Highlands Protection Authority with assistance from the Asian Development Bank (ADB).

 

However, the President pointed out that while it may take decades to restore the Central Highlands to their former state, immediate measures must be taken to halt the ongoing destruction.

 

Describing the Central Highlands as the heart of Sri Lanka, the President noted that the region is being destroyed before the country’s eyes. He added that he had witnessed landslides, the drying up of natural springs, and the siltation of rivers and streams.

 

Accordingly, once the Bill is passed, full authority will be vested in the Central Highlands Protection Authority, he said.

 

Meanwhile, the President stated that steps are being taken to ensure that the Malaiyaha Tamil community enjoys full rights and lives as equal citizens of the country. 

 

As part of these efforts, he said that when agreements with plantation companies are renewed after their current terms expire in 2042, the new agreements will be formulated in a manner that safeguards the rights of the community.

 

Furthermore, the President stated that the Cabinet has taken steps to remove obstacles preventing people who left Sri Lanka for India during the war from returning to the country.
